Usually, we use the number line to solve inequalities with the symbols,
<
,
≤
,
>
, and
≥
.(the second and last one was rather hard to find on my keyboard) In order to solve an inequality using the number line, though, just turn
the inequality sign to an equal sign. Then, solve the equation. Next step,
graph the point on the number line (remember to graph as an open circle if the
original inequality was <, or >). The number line should now be
divided into 2 regions, one to the left of the graphed point, and one to the
right of said point.
After that, pick a point in both regions and "test" it, check to see if it satisfies
the inequality when plugged in for the variable. If it does, draw a darker line from the point into that region, with an
arrow at the end. That is the solution to the equation: if one
point in the region satisfies the inequality, the entire region will
satisfy the inequality.

Answer:
x=38
Step-by-step explanation:
First, know that the sum of the angles in a triangle is 180.
Then, add the angles. 2x+38+x+x-10.
Make them equal to 180.
2x+38+x+x-10=180
Simplify.
4x+28=180
Subtract 28 from 180.
4x=152
Divide 4 from 152 to make x alone.
x=38
